what will happen if petrol engine make to run with diesel
Answer / Tarakeshwar Kumar Puri
Running a petrol engine with diesel can cause significant damage. Diesel fuel contains more impurities than petrol, which can lead to engine knocking, poor combustion, increased emissions, and potential engine failure.
